0028180: Visualization, TKOpenGl - Performance of Shaded presentation dropped due to FFP disabled by default FFP state management (light sources, matrices, clipping planes) has been moved to OpenGl_ShaderManager for consistency with Programmable Pipeline. OpenGl_Context::BindProgram() does not re-bind already active Program. OpenGl_PrimitiveArray::Render() does not reset active Program at the end. OpenGl_Context::ApplyModelViewMatrix() now checks if matrix differs from already set one before modifying state in Shader Manager. This allows avoing redundant state changes, matrix uploads onto GPU and re-computation of inversed matrices. NCollection_Mat4 has been extended with equality check operators for proper comparison. OpenGl_ShaderManager - the tracking Material state has been added. Removed unreachable states OPENGL_NS_RESMAT, OPENGL_NS_TEXTURE and OPENGL_NS_WHITEBACK. Fixed resetting FFP material state after displaying GL_COLOR_ARRAY vertices; the Material state within Shader Manager is now invalidated within OpenGl_VertexBuffer::unbindFixedColor(). OpenGl_Workspace::ApplyAspectFace() - fixed invalidating Material State when only Highlighting style is changing.

0024406: Visualization - crash on re-usage of the same primitive array Redesign Graphic3d_ArrayOfPrimitives Store vertices data in buffer objects managed using smart-pointers - no more low-level memory corruption by memory releasing after VBO creation. Remove broken hasEdgeInfos. Interleave vertex attributes (position, color, normal, uv) in single buffer. Remove from Graphic3d_ArrayOfPrimitives methods ::Orientate(). Remove structures Graphic3d_PrimitiveArray, CALL_DEF_PARRAY. Add support for 2D vertex arrays. Graphic3d_Group - remove array or primitive arrays. Introduce more universal method Graphic3d_Group::AddPrimitiveArray(). Fix warning
